Output 03fffe26141bc427e8f820b962ebfaa4eeb113d79d8f9f58d0e22fa3e35a1ec6:3

value
1644086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d508d82046fc0e166b6d89a52a13c1cb84bd573 OP_EQUAL
address
3ACRGHfr4Vo9rxGyuRR9AHTg6SeM7HpKJ7
transaction
03fffe26141bc427e8f820b962ebfaa4eeb113d79d8f9f58d0e22fa3e35a1ec6
spent
true